PS4 Update 4.07 Out Now, Here's What It Does (Not Much)

The newest PS4 update has landed.

A new PlayStation 4 system update has arrived, but don't expect any new features.

Like others before it, 4.07 is focused on improving the quality of the PS4's system performance. The one-line patch notes state: "This system software update improves the quality of the system performance." It's a relatively small patch, coming in at 312.3 MB, according to DualShockers.

The wording of the 4.07 patch is identical to that of the previous 4.06 and 4.05 patches.

Sony (and Microsoft for its part) do not historically launch major, feature-rich system updates during the holiday months. The PS4's last significant update, 4.00, came out in September.

It introduced folders for managing games and apps, while some menus were also redesigned. PS4 4.00 also added HDR support for all PS4s. You can see everything new and changed for PS4 4.00 in GameSpot's previous report.

In other PS4 news, Sony announced this week that the console has crossed 50 million sales worldwide and that this year's Black Friday week was the best in the history of PlayStation for sales.
